Location and Tour Overview

afternoon-old-town-food-tour

The Afternoon Old Town Food Tour takes place in the historic Old Town district of Lyon, France, a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its well-preserved medieval and Renaissance architecture.

This highly-rated culinary walking tour, with 257 reviews and a 4.8/5 rating, showcases the local specialties of the region. Lasting approximately 3 hours, the tour accommodates a maximum of 12 travelers and features 4 tasting stops, where participants can sample cheese, charcuterie, regional wines, and more.

The tour is priced at $73.47 per person and includes a passionate local guide, snacks, and alcoholic beverages.

Tasting Stops and Potential Bites

As participants embark on the Afternoon Old Town Food Tour, they’ll savor a diverse array of local specialties across 4 tasting stops. The menu might include:

Tasting Stop Potential Bites
Stop 1 Regional cold cuts with red wine
Stop 2 Artisanal ice creams
Stop 3 Regional cheeses with white wine
Stop 4 Lyonnais beer with grand cru chocolate, praline pie with hot drinks

Inclusions and Meeting Information

afternoon-old-town-food-tour

The tour includes 4 tasting breaks where participants can savor local specialties.

Along with the tastings, the experience features a passionate local guide who shares insight into Lyon’s rich culinary heritage.

Alcoholic beverages and snacks are provided, and gratuities are included, making this a hassle-free outing.

The tour meets at 3 Place du Change, in front of a pharmacy, and concludes at 66 Rue Saint-Jean in Old Town.

With convenient public transportation access and free cancellation up to 24 hours prior, this food tour offers an immersive taste of Lyon’s gastronomic delights.
